Corean Women.
Corean women, to the Western eye, are both hideous and ungainly, whereas the men and youpg hoys are often handsome and picturesque. There is neither grace nor" elegance in the fe-‘ male rlress, which in some respects resembles that of the Chinese, and consists of a loose pair of trousers reaching to the ankle, and tied round the waist with a thick cord; on the top of this Is worn a short petticoat reaching ' to the knees, and fitted to the shoulder is a yoke or shoulder-cape, to which are attached lbng loose sleeves. This costume Is the ordinary dress of the worklng-womffip. \ -
